git使用簡單指南

2022-03-01 13:32:18 字數 1617 閱讀 4959

參考:

git建庫小結

2、其他,.gitignore檔案,設定不需要上傳的目錄和檔案,內容如下

# myself define

*.pyc

.idea/

migrations/

data/

filedata/

*.log

log/

# byte-compiled / optimized / dll files

__pycache__/

*.py[cod]

*$py.class

# c extensions

*.so

(二)本地:

1、安裝git客戶端

2、建立公鑰(3次enter):一台機器,只需要建立一次

ssh-keygen -t rsa -c [email protected]:andy/fullspider.git

將公鑰**複製到git遠端。

如果匹配成功後,以後就不需要密碼了。

3、新建乙個使用者資料夾:

如user01

4、將遠端倉庫拉到本地:

進入user01/,右鍵git命令框

將遠端倉庫複製到拉到本地:git clone [email protected]:andy/fullspider.git

此時,本地user01/下,就多了fullspider專案大檔案。

(三)在本地新建分支,並把分支推送到遠端

操作拉下來的專案資料夾

1、切換路徑,開始操作

cd fullspider

2、新建本地dev分支,並推送到遠端倉庫

git checkout -b dev

git push origin dev

3、將本地dev分支和遠端dev分支建立跟蹤關係。(就是和遠端的dev進行對比)

git branch --set-upstream-to=origin/dev dev

(四)在本地新建檔案,並推送到遠端分支

專案大資料夾中放入乙個新檔案,並上傳到遠端

1、先檢視變化(未提交快取、已提交快取):

git status 新建、修改、刪除都可見

git diff 新建不可見。(未提交快取)

git diff --cached (已經提交快取)

2、新增到快取,點號表示所有檔案

git add .

3、提交本地版本庫。表示完成乙個業務邏輯

git commit -m '第一次提交'

4、推送到遠端分支

git push origin dev

或者git push

(五)檢視本地版本,版本回退

1、檢視本地版本(可見回退版本號)

git reflog

或者(沒有版本號)

git log

2、將遠端dev版本更新到本地

git pull origin dev

3、回退到版本

git reset 8042a87

(六)分支合併

簡單的分支合併:將分支b合併到公共分支a上

git  checkout  a

git  merge  b

git  push origin  a

Git簡單指令

1.git init 把這個目錄變成git可以管理的倉庫 2.git add readme.txt 新增到暫存區裡面去 3.git commit m readme.txt提交 用命令 git commit告訴git,把檔案提交到倉庫 4.git status 來檢視是否還有檔案未提交 5.git d...

git 簡單指令

檢視狀態 git status 檢視當前所屬分支 git branch 新增新內容 git add 提交並注釋 git commit m 注釋 推送倉庫 git push 切換分支 git checkout 新建分支 git checkout b 新建分支推送到倉庫 git push u origi...

git簡單指令

命令 options 引數 引數可選 為主功能的擴充套件 分為三種模式 命令模式 插入模式 底行模式 開啟 建立檔案,vi 路徑 輸入模式 esc i a 命令臺模式 esc shift 末行模式 底行模式 w 儲存,w filename 另存為 q 退出 wq 儲存並退出 e 撤銷更改,返回上一次...